2. What Are Axles and Shafts?
Axles and shafts are integral parts of a vehicle's drivetrain system. They are responsible for transmitting power from the engine to the wheels, enabling the vehicle to move forward or backward. Axles are robust, rod-like structures that connect the wheels on each side of the vehicle. On the other hand, shafts are cylindrical components that transfer rotational energy from one part of the drivetrain to another.
3. The Functions of Axles and Shafts in a Vehicle
Axles and shafts perform several vital functions in a vehicle, including:
- Supporting the weight of the vehicle: Axles bear the weight of the vehicle and its occupants, ensuring stable and safe driving conditions.
- Transferring power: Axles and shafts transmit power from the engine to the wheels, allowing the vehicle to move efficiently.
- Facilitating steering: Front axles play a crucial role in enabling the steering mechanism, allowing the driver to control the direction of the vehicle.
- Absorbing shocks: Rear axles equipped with suspension systems absorb shocks and vibrations, providing a smoother ride for passengers.
- Maintaining wheel alignment: Axles and shafts help maintain proper wheel alignment, ensuring even tire wear and optimal handling.
4. Different Types of Axles and Shafts
There are various types of axles and shafts used in vehicles, depending on the vehicle's design and purpose. Let's explore some common types:
4.1 Front Axles and Shafts
Front axles are primarily responsible for supporting the vehicle's weight and enabling steering. They consist of two half-shafts connected to the front wheels, allowing them to rotate and change direction as needed.
4.2 Rear Axles and Shafts
Rear axles, also known as drive axles, transfer power from the transmission to the rear wheels. They may incorporate additional components such as differential gears to distribute power evenly between the two rear wheels.
4.3 Drive Shafts and Propeller Shafts
Drive shafts, commonly found in rear-wheel-drive and all-wheel-drive vehicles, transmit power from the transmission to the rear or front axles. Propeller shafts, on the other hand, are used in vehicles with a longitudinal engine orientation, such as trucks and SUVs.
5. The Role of Axles and Shafts in Power Transmission
Axles and shafts play a critical role in power transmission within a vehicle's drivetrain system. They deliver torque generated by the engine to the wheels, enabling the vehicle to move. The rotational energy from the engine is transferred along the driveline, through the transmission, to the axles and shafts, and finally to the wheels.
6. Ensuring the Proper Maintenance of Axles and Shafts
To ensure the longevity and optimal performance of your vehicle's axles and shafts, regular maintenance is essential. Here are some maintenance tips:
- Regular inspections: Inspect the axles and shafts for any signs of damage, such as leaks, cracks, or excessive wear. Address any issues promptly to prevent further damage.
- Lubrication: Proper lubrication of axles and shafts is crucial to reduce friction and prevent premature wear. Follow the manufacturer's recommendations for lubrication intervals and use the recommended lubricants.
- Wheel alignment: Proper wheel alignment helps distribute the vehicle's weight evenly across the axles and shafts, reducing strain on these components. Regularly check and adjust wheel alignment as necessary.
- Suspension maintenance: Maintain the suspension system to ensure the axles and shafts can absorb shocks and vibrations effectively. Replace worn-out suspension components as needed.
